Billy Duffy from The Cult does, and he's one of the rare guitarists that have made it his trademark guitar, and he's managed to make it suit his image and playing style. Billy Duffy has been playing the Gretsch White Falcon for decades and has a wide collection from vintage 1970's models, to the most current new productions. If he doesn't know about the White Falcon then who does. The White Falcon from the 70's although looked great, had no output and not suitable for gigs. Billy Duffy used to swap the pickups with custom made Seymour Duncans. Billy Duffy bought his first double cutaway White Falcon in 1982 using all his life savings to buy it, commiting his life to Rock N' Roll and music.
